Combined vacuum cup structure
By using a modular thermos structure with threaded connections and magnetic blocks, the first and second cup bodies can be detachably connected, solving the problem that existing thermoses cannot hold different beverages at the same time and improving ease of use.

[0001] The utility model relates to the technical field of vacuum cup, especially to a combined vacuum cup structure. BACKGROUND
[0002] Vacuum cup is a common daily necessities, generally is by ceramic or stainless steel plus vacuum layer makes the container that holds water, it is convenient for people to replenish water, with the improvement of living standards, people's demand for vacuum cup is higher and higher, generally vacuum cup mostly only sets up a cavity for holding cold water, hot water or other drinks, the user can only choose one according to the demand at that time, when needing to drink other drinks, need to drink or pour off the water in the cup before can be held, the function is single, if holding two kinds of liquid needs to prepare another vacuum cup, it is very inconvenient. [0021] Embodiment: Reference Figures 1-2The shown combined cup structure, including a first cup body 1 and a second cup body 2, the first cup body 1 is installed at the top end of the second cup body 2 and the first cup body 1 and the second cup body 2 are threadedly detachable connected, the inside of the first cup body 1 is provided with a first beverage cavity 3, the inside of the second cup body 2 is provided with a second beverage cavity 4, the top end of the first beverage cavity 3 and the second beverage cavity 4 are both in the form of opening, the bottom end of the first cup body 1 is provided with a communication port 5, the communication port 5 communicates the first beverage cavity 3 and the second beverage cavity 4, one side of the first cup body 1 is provided with a groove 10, a shutter 6 is inserted at the groove 10 and is slidably connected with the first cup body 1, the shutter 6 can be inserted into the communication port 5 to block the communication port 5, a first magnetic block 9 is fixedly installed at the outer end of the shutter 6, a second magnetic block 11 is fixedly installed at the inner end of the groove 10, the first magnetic block 9 and the second magnetic block 11 are magnetically attracted, so that the shutter can be fixed, the first cup body and the second cup body are threadedly detachable connected, after being detached, the first cup body and the second cup body can separately hold beverages, the types of beverages can be different, when the types of beverages are the same, the first cup body and the second cup body do not need to be detached, the shutter is pulled to open the communication port, so that the first beverage cavity and the second beverage cavity are communicated for drinking, which is convenient to use.
[0022] By the above structure: the outer end of the shutter 6 is provided with a pull ring 7 fixedly connected therewith, which facilitates pulling the shutter.
[0023] By the above structure: the top end of the first cup body 1 is provided with a cup cover 8, the cup cover 8 and the first cup body 1 are threadedly detachable connected.
[0024] By the above structure: the outside of the cup cover 8 is sleeved and installed with a first sealing ring 13 which is sealed with the inner wall of the first beverage cavity 3.
[0025] By the above structure: the bottom end of the first cup body 1 is fixedly installed with a second sealing ring 14 which is adaptively and sealingly attached to the top end of the second cup body 2 near the outer periphery.
[0026] By the above structure: the top end of the cup cover 8 is provided with a handle 12 fixedly connected therewith, which facilitates carrying the cup through the handle.
[0027] By the above structure: the first cup body 1 and the second cup body 2 are both vacuum cups.
